Tire fabric, typically made from polyester, nylon, or steel, is the backbone of tire strength and performance. The choice of fabric not only affects the tire’s durability and safety but also its ecological footprint. As environmental awareness rises, manufacturers are increasingly scrutinizing the materials used in tire production to enhance sustainability efforts. So, how does tire fabric impact these efforts?

First and foremost, the type of material used in tire fabric has direct implications for the recycling potential of tires. Traditional tire fabrics, such as petroleum-based materials, present challenges when it comes to recycling. These materials often cannot be reclaimed effectively, leading to tires that end up in landfills or that require extensive energy to repurpose. In contrast, emerging materials made from natural fibers—such as cotton or hemp—are making waves within the industry due to their renewability and recyclability. By substituting synthetic fibers with sustainable alternatives, manufacturers can significantly reduce the life cycle environmental impact of tires.

Moreover, the manufacturing processes of these tire fabrics also demand attention. Producing polyester or nylon can result in high CO2 emissions and considerable water consumption. In contrast, natural fiber production often uses fewer resources, aligning better with eco-friendly standards. By optimizing the fabric blends and production techniques, companies are discovering avenues for reducing their carbon footprint while adhering to sustainability goals.

One innovative approach recently gaining traction is the development of tire fabrics derived from waste materials. Some companies are experimenting with integrating recycled plastics into tire manufacturing, effectively giving a second life to materials that would otherwise contribute to pollution. By transforming trash into tire fabric, manufacturers are closing the loop on textile waste and paving new pathways for eco-conscious tire production.

Additionally, the performance of tire fabric plays a vital role in vehicle efficiency. Tires made with lighter, high-quality fabrics can improve fuel efficiency by reducing rolling resistance. This boost in performance not only enhances vehicle safety and durability but also contributes to lower fuel consumption, directly influencing greenhouse gas emissions. A tire that performs better under various conditions can extend its life, which means fewer replacements and better overall sustainability metrics in the automotive industry.
